Maryam 19:45

يَٰٓأَبَتِ إِنِّىٓ أَخَافُ أَن يَمَسَّكَ عَذَابٌۭ مِّنَ ٱلرَّحْمَٰنِ فَتَكُونَ لِلشَّيْطَٰنِ وَلِيًّۭا

PICKTHALL ENGLISH MEANING

O my father! Lo! I fear lest a punishment from the Beneficent overtake thee so that thou become a comrade of the devil.

Family

Caring for those entrusted to you.

Reading “O my father” in Maryam 19:45 places the responsibilities and tenderness that shape family life across generations within a real human situation. Pause before Allah and examine which family responsibility calls for more patience, justice, or tenderness from you.

This is a personal reflection prompt, not tafsir. For interpretation, consult qualified scholarship and the ayah’s wider Quranic context.
